Light Requirements
Lettuce requires a good amount of light to produce properly . In a aquicultural arrangement , you could provide this lighter with grow lights or by placing your system of rules near a gay windowpane .
Ideally , lettuce should receive around12 - 16 hoursof lightness per day . If you ’re using grow visible radiation , adjust their height as the moolah grows to ensure they ’re always at the proper aloofness .
Nutrient Needs
Lettuce gets all its nutrients from the urine in a hydroponic organisation . You ’ll necessitate to on a regular basis bestow nutrient to the water to ensure your plants get everything they need .
you’re able to purchase pre - made alimental solutions or mix your own using a aquacultural alimentary mix and water .
Ensure to come after the instructions carefully , as over - fertilizing can be as harmful as under - fertilizing .

Water and pH Levels
The water in your aquacultural system should be regularly monitored and changed to guarantee it remain clean and complimentary of harmful bacteria .
you’re able to utilise a pee examination kit to check the pH and nutrient levels of the water . The optimal pH reach for lettuce is between6.0 and 6.5 .
If the pH is too high or too low , you ’ll need to adjust it using pH up or down solutions . Additionally , change the water in your system of rules every two to three weeks to forbid the buildup of harmful bacteria .
